How much do digital content editor j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average hourly pay for digital content editor in Seattle, WA is $41.04,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$31.20 and $47.60 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a digital content editor do?

A Digital Content Editor is responsible for creating, editing, and managing content published on digital platforms such as websites, blogs, and social media. They ensure that all content is accurate, engaging, and aligns with the brand's voice and goals. Their duties often include proofreading, optimizing content for SEO, collaborating with writers and designers, and tracking content performance using analytics tools. Digital Content Editors play a crucial role in maintaining a consistent online presence and improving user engagement.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a digital content editor?

To thrive as a Digital Content Editor, you need strong writing, editing, and proofreading skills, often supported by a degree in communications, journalism, or a related field.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S) like WordPress, SEO tools, and analytics platforms is typically required. Attention to detail, creativity, and effective collaboration are standout soft skills for this role. These skills ensure the creation of high-quality, engaging content that meets both audience needs and business goals in a digital environment.

How does a digital content editor collaborate with writers, designers, and other team members?

Digital Content Editors play a central role in coordinating content projects, often working closely with writers to refine messaging and ensure clarity, as well as collaborating with designers to align visuals with editorial guidelines. They may participate in regular editorial meetings, provide feedback on drafts, and use project management tools to track progress. Open communication and constructive feedback are key, as editors act as a bridge between creative contributors and organizational goals, ensuring content is both engaging and consistent across digital channels.

What is the difference between Digital Content Editor vs Content Writer?

AspectDigital Content EditorContent Writer
Primary RoleOversees content quality, editing, and publishing across digital platformsCreates and writes original content for various formats
Skills & CredentialsEditing, SEO, content management systems, strong writing skillsWriting, research, SEO basics, storytelling
Work EnvironmentDigital marketing teams, media companies, online publishersContent agencies, marketing teams, freelance platforms

The Digital Content Editor focuses on managing, editing, and optimizing digital content, ensuring consistency and quality. Content Writers primarily produce original written material. Both roles require strong writing skills and familiarity with SEO, but the editor emphasizes editing and content strategy, while the writer emphasizes content creation.

Position Summary
Classical KING is seeking a creative, collaborative, and highly organized Digital Content Specialist to help bring the organization's programming, partnerships, artists, hosts, and community stories to life across digital platforms.
This role combines multimedia production, digital content creation, project coordination, and editorial stewardship to ensure audiences experience Classical KING consistently across broadcast, web, social media, streaming platforms, email, video, and emerging digital channels.
Working from strategic priorities established by organizational leadership, the Digital Content Specialist transforms ideas into polished, engaging digital experiences through thoughtful production, coordination, and storytelling.
Key Responsibilities
Create digital content: Produce photography, video, interviews, articles, and multimedia stories that bring Classical KING's programming, artists, hosts, partners, and community work to life across digital platforms.
Support on-camera storytelling: Prepare questions, talking points, production plans, and participant guidance that help people communicate naturally and confidently on camera.
Coordinate digital projects: Manage production schedules, assets, approvals, publishing timelines, and cross-functional workflows from concept through publication.
Collaborate across teams: Work with Programming, Partnerships, Advancement, Digital Growth, and external creative partners to extend on-air, community, and partnership work across web, social, video, email, and other channels.
Edit, publish, and organize content: Adapt content for the website, social media, YouTube, email, and shared asset libraries, including light photo and video editing as needed.
Maintain quality and consistency: Review digital content for accessibility, accuracy, metadata, editorial quality, and alignment with Classical KING's brand and standards.
Improve tools and workflows: Support website updates, production templates, shared processes, performance reporting, and thoughtful use of evolving digital and AI-assisted tools.
Build strong relationships: Work respectfully and collaboratively with artists, staff, volunteers, donors, sponsors, and community partners.
